Right-angle lock-type compressor piston ring
A piston ring and lock-type technology, which is applied in the field of compressors, can solve the problems of affecting the airtightness of compressors, failure to obtain initial elastic force, and large gaps, etc., and achieves high stability, improved utilization, and simple installation.

Embodiment 1
[0023] A right-angle lock type compressor piston ring, including a main piston ring and an inner auxiliary piston ring that are used in combination and are of the same height.
